This is the default mode for VGUI. It is also a standalone program that can be executed by the operating system's clock function, by hand, or remotely by an authorized process. Robotmode examines the entire VSTK security suite of tools and determines which tools need configuration. If the user has already configured a tool then no further configuration will be made by Robotmode. The program then configures any tools that still require configuration, creates any databases that has not already been created and then executes all of the security tools in the most logical sequence possible.
If a CIT database has not been created then Robotmode will create a CIT database for the entire system while simultaneously virus scanning the system using UAD and VFind with Loop Back. If an Avatar configuration file has not been created then it will create one followed by executing Avatar Create to create the Avatar database. It will also run THD and all of the other security tools as predetermined to be appropriate by CyberSoft.
The second time Robotmode runs all of the tools will have already been configured and the databases built, either by Robotmode or by the user. At this point, Robotmode will run CIT, VFind, UAD, LBH with LBT, THD and Avatar Check/Correct. If necessary it will also run MvFilter to remove any macro viruses.
Robotmode will continue to expand over its life cycle. It is the first attempt to force discipline into a process that was previously inconsistent by means of automation. Robotmode encapsulates best practices for the use of the VSTK tools.
Also see:
VFind | VFind Daemon | MvFilter | CIT | UAD | THD | Bhead | JDIS | VGUI | MiniWeb Server
Robotmode | Avatar | NTI | NTI-CRYPTO | Unix Wrappers | RMI